The net worth of Vishay Precision Group is the difference between its total assets and liabilities. Vishay Precision's net worth represents the value of the company's equity or ownership interest. In other words, it is the amount of money that would be left over if all of Vishay Precision's assets were sold and all of its debts were paid off. Net worth is sometimes referred to as shareholder's equity or book value. Vishay Precision's net worth can be used as a measure of its financial health and stability which can help investors to decide if Vishay Precision is a good investment. It is also essential in determining the company's creditworthiness and ability to secure financing before investing in Vishay Precision Group stock.

Vishay Precision's net worth analysis, or its valuation, is the process of determining the total value of the company. This involves assessing a range of factors, including Vishay Precision's financial performance, assets, liabilities, and potential for growth. The ultimate goal is to provide a clear understanding of Vishay Precision's overall worth, which can help investors make informed investment decisions. There are several methods that can be used to perform Vishay Precision's net worth analysis. One common approach is to calculate Vishay Precision's market capitalization.Another approach is to use the price-to-earnings ratio (P/E ratio), which compares Vishay Precision's stock price to its earnings per share (EPS). Disc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is is another popular method for assessing Vishay Precision's net worth. This approach calculates the present value of Vishay Precision's future cash flows, taking into account factors such as growth rate, profitability, and risk. By comparing the present value of Vishay Precision's cash flows to its current stock price, investors can gain a better understanding of the company's overall value. Finally, investors may use comparable company analysis to evaluate Vishay Precision's net worth. This involves comparing Vishay Precision's financial metrics to similar companies in the same industry. By identifying companies with similar financial characteristics, investors can gain insight into Vishay Precision's net worth relative to its peers.

Some recent studies suggest that insider trading raises the cost of capital for securities issuers and decreases overall economic growth. Trading by specific Vishay Precision insiders, such as employees or executives, is commonly permitted as long as it does not rely on Vishay Precision's material information that is not in the public domain. Local jurisdictions usually require such trading to be reported in order to monitor insider transactions. In many U.S. states, trading conducted by corporate officers, key employees, directors, or significant shareholders must be reported to the regulator or publicly disclosed, usually within a few business days of the trade. In these cases Vishay Precision insiders are required to file a Form 4 with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) when buying or selling shares of their own companies.

The market value of Vishay Precision is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Vishay that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Vishay Precision's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Vishay Precision's true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because Vishay Precision's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Vishay Precision's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Vishay Precision's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Vishay Precision is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Vishay Precision's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
